Monthly Progress Report 03-27-07


Completed Tasks through March 25, 2007

  • Continued dialog with Kansas Department Health and Environment (KDHE) regarding review of the Siting Study.  Draft Wakarusa River modeling report reviewed with KDHE on March 21, 2007.
  • Submitted zoning, annexation, and preliminary plat information for the WRF site to the City Manager’s Office for review prior to submission to planning staff.
  • Met with staff and property acquisition team to select proposed pipeline corridor and west influent pumping station location.
  • Disinfection, odor control, and preliminary treatment draft memorandums completed.  Discussed with staff on March 2, 2007.
  • Design flows and loads, liquid treatment, and solids treatment memorandums updated for results of Volatile Fatty Acids (VFA) sampling program.
  • Began preparation of preliminary hydraulic profile and mass balance for the Wakarusa WRF.
  • Began discussions with property owners along proposed corridor route and pumping station locations.

Taks for April 2007

  • Finalize Siting Study based on Comments received from City Commission, City Staff, and KDHE.  Re-Submit Siting Study to Owner as required.
  • Continue to support City in annexation, zoning, and platting of Wakarusa WRF Site.
  • Incorporate KDHE comments into Wakarusa River modeling report to allow Permit to progress to Public Comment phase.
  • Submit Draft Basis of Design Report to staff for review.
  • Begin development of Process and Instrumentation Diagrams as well as the Basis of Design Memorandum.
  • Hold meeting to update Public Advisory Subcommittee Representatives on next steps.
  • Prepare for on-site investigations along pipeline corridor and pumping station locations.
